Job Title: Aircraft Mechanic Job Description

We are seeking a skilled Aircraft Mechanic to join our team at a Class IV 14 CFR Part 145 certified repair station. Our facility specializes in aircraft maintenance, covering everything from narrow to wide body, small to large, regional to long-haul aircraft. Join us in maintaining one of the largest storage and reclamation operations in the world.

Responsibilities

Research technical data and perform disassembly, repair, cleaning, adjustment, assembly, testing, and calibration of aircraft components using company tools and ground equipment. Repair, replace, and rebuild aircraft structures such as wings, fuselage, and functional components including rigging, surface controls, plumbing, and hydraulic units. Read and interpret manufacturers' and airlines maintenance manuals, service bulletins, and other specifications to determine the feasibility and method of repairing or replacing malfunctioning or damaged components. Complete identification, inspections, routing tags, and forms for removed units and make entries into the Component Removal Log. Disassemble and inspect aircraft and engine parts for wear or other defects. Repair or replace defective engine parts, reassemble, and install engines in aircraft. Adjust, repair, or replace electrical wiring systems and aircraft accessories. Perform miscellaneous duties to service aircraft, including cleaning, servicing, greasing, moving parts, and checking brakes.

Work Environment

The work environment involves physical demands such as sitting, standing, and walking for extended periods, frequent bending, stooping, and reaching above shoulder level. Occasionally, employees may need to crawl, climb, or lift up to 50 pounds unassisted. The role requires eye-hand coordination, manual dexterity, and corrected vision and hearing to normal range. Employees will operate aircraft ground servicing equipment and hand tools, and work within an aircraft maintenance hangar with exposure to high noise levels, temperature changes, and materials identified on Safety Data Sheets. Protective equipment such as goggles, safety glasses, face shields, ear protection, aprons, gloves, and safety harnesses is required.
